Transaction 5e8b6b77e90715bdb5cd2922136a845e57aa5c34a703a2c61d2132d33d43a377

2 Input
1 Outputs
  • 5e8b6b77e90715bdb5cd2922136a845e57aa5c34a703a2c61d2132d33d43a377:0
  • value  1325072
    address  3ChESt9uAkaHTuDgzL6fWEyjdgVmhNCbG6